Output 2ecf13d4ac94858b0e380db0790553432733b471dca9422d6b8a3e72fbb8e162:2

value
288255868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45d2ad60270a88e989a2190d1af0a6c51f1807b OP_EQUAL
address
3J8hATD2Lb8sLdUrPeCcZg5gGKsketyLX5
transaction
2ecf13d4ac94858b0e380db0790553432733b471dca9422d6b8a3e72fbb8e162
spent
true